Drawing’s origin:
“Grace was originally drawn as a commission for a client visiting from Australia. The Red Fox was introduced into Australia in the 1830s for the traditional English sport of fox hunting. They adapted to their new climate too well, and are now classified as a pest – but still they are quietly loved by a few. In folklore, they are a symbol of cunning and trickery; and often are used to depict intelligence overcoming both malevolence and brute strength. Grace was inspired by the song ‘Far from Grace’ by The Doves.”
